Steak and Shrimp Kabobs in the Air Fryer: The Ultimate Guide to a Perfect Surf-and-Turf Meal

These Steak and Shrimp Kabobs in the Air Fryer are a quick and flavorful surf-and-turf meal that’s perfect for busy weeknights or entertaining guests. Juicy steak bites and buttery shrimp cook evenly in the air fryer, giving you a restaurant-quality dish with minimal effort and cleanup.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ound boneless sirloin steak

  • 1 pound raw jumbo shrimp, peeled and deveined

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il

  • 2 tablespoons steak seasoning

Instructions

  • Pat the steak dry with paper towels and cut it into 1-inch pieces. Pat the shrimp dry as well.

  • In a large bowl, combine the steak, shrimp, and olive oil. Toss until evenly coated.

  • Thread the steak and shrimp onto the skewers, alternating pieces if desired.

  • Place the kabobs in the air fryer basket in a single layer.

  • Cook at 400°F (205°C) for 3 minutes per side, turning once, until the shrimp are opaque and cooked through and the steak reaches your preferred doneness.

  • Serve immediately and enjoy.

Notes

  • Soak wooden skewers in water for at least 30 minutes to prevent burning.

  • Cut steak evenly so it cooks at the same rate as the shrimp.

  • Do not overcrowd the air fryer basket—cook in batches if necessary.

  • Check doneness early, as air fryers can vary in cooking speed.

  • Add vegetables like bell peppers or onions to the skewers for extra color and flavor.
